Scaffold and maintain a file-driven Next.js litigation-tracker site for any federal case, fed by CourtListener.
Spin up a tracker for <case> — scaffold a complete file-driven Next.js litigation-tracker website for a NEW federal case, modeled on the bundled template. Use when the user wants to "spin up a tracker for <case>", "build a tracker like the DoW one for a new case", "scaffold a litigation tracker", or reproduce the Anthropic v. U.S. Dept of War tracker workflow for another lawsuit. Copies the bundled Next.js app, fills the docket set from CourtListener, classifies/appends entries, and drafts the legal-narrative layer for the user's review.
Refresh an existing docket-tracker site with the latest filings. Use when the user says "refresh my tracker", "pull the latest docket entries", "sync the tracker", "update the docket", or "check for new filings" while inside a scaffolded tracker repo. For every docket in case-meta.yaml it pulls new CourtListener entries (all importances, labeled), appends them, refreshes the RECAP-status sidecar, surfaces any pending news, runs the build gate, and reports what changed. Distinct from /docket-tracker:new (which scaffolds a new tracker from scratch). Commit/deploy stays the user's call.
